Power Play – Lubrizol Soars on Berkshire Hathaway Acquisition

Lubrizol Corporation (NYSE: LZ) shares surged nearly 28% in today’s trading on word the specialty chemical company will be acquired by billionaire Warren Buffett’s Berkshire Hathaway for $135 per share or for a total value of about $9.7 billion, including $0.7 billion in net debt. Both companies have unanimously approved the transaction. The companies expect to close the transaction during the third quarter of 2011. Upon completion of the deal, Lubrizol is expected to operate as a subsidiary of Berkshire Hathaway, providing technology, service and global supply chain support to its customers.

The company reported a rise in fourth-quarter profit, as revenues went up 11%. The net income for the fourth quarter increased to $156.7 million or $2.35 per share from $134.2 million or $1.92 per share in the previous year. The results for the quarter included restructuring and impairment charges $0.10 per share in pension settlements related to the closure of the company’s Canadian additives facility. Excluding charges, earnings were $163.8 million or $2.45 per share, up from $136 million or $1.95 per share in the prior year. The revenues for the quarter rose 11% to $1.32 billion from $1.19 billion in the same quarter last year. This increase was mainly due to a 9% improvement in combination of price and product mix and 4% higher volume.

For the full year, net income increased to $732.2 million or $10.64 per share from $500.8 million or $7.26 per share in the preceding year. Revenues grew to $5.42 billion from $4.59 billion a year ago.

The company expects earnings in the range of $11.05 to $11.55 per share. It expects an increase of 12% to 17% compared with 2010 pro forma adjusted earnings of $9.91 per share, which excludes restructuring and impairment charges and the significant tax benefits recognized in 2010.

Lubrizol Corporation stock is currently trading at $133.97. The stock is up 27.08% from its previous close. Lubrizol Corporation stock touched the high of $134.20 and lowest price in today�s session is $133.25. The company stock has traded in the range of $77.65 and $134.20 during the past 52 weeks. The company�s market cap is $8.58 billion.
